WebDefective or missing handrails or guardrails. Injuries at post offices, tax offices, libraries, public housing, and more. Federal, state, and local governments are responsible for making government property safe for visitors, including private individuals and civilian contractors hired to make repairs or improvements. WebWorkers’ compensation insurance provides benefits to nearly all employees in the U.S. who are injured on the job. An injury at work can be anything from a fall at a construction site to a trip over a phone cord in an office setting.
